This Heritage Month, we celebrate the timeless sounds of Indian classical music with a very special guest — Prof. Anantha Narayanan of Chennai. A renowned veena virtuoso, honoured with the title Bharatha Vani Nipuna, Prof. Narayanan has performed for All India Radio, Doordarshan-Kendra, and global music festivals alongside the Kalakshetra Foundation. Currently touring South Africa, he joins us in studio to share insights into the spiritual practice of the veena, the depth of Indian classical ragas, and the role of music in nurturing creativity across generations. Plus, listeners are treated to a live recital that brings centuries of devotion and tradition to life.
